Parmesan Eggy Bread

Parmesan Eggy Bread
Preparation time is 10minutes
Cook time is 14minutes
Total time is 24minutes
Serve is for 6 people

Difficulty level: 2 out of 4

12 Ingredients

Number of servings
6
  • 6 plum tomatoes
  • 4tablespoons ready-made olive tapenade
  • 6tablespoons extra virgin olive oil (for drizzling)
  • 2/3 cup milk
  • 3 eggs
  • 3tablespoons Parmesan cheese, freshly grated
  • 50grams butter
  • 6 slices white bread
  • 1 handful baby spinach leaves
  • 3 basil leaves (to serve)
  • 1 pinch salt
  • 1 pinch black pepper

Method

Step 1 of 3

Cut the tomatoes in half and scoop out the seeds. Arrange cut-side up in a baking dish. Spoon a little of the tapenade on to each tomato and drizzle over some oil. Cook under a preheated hot grill for 2-3 minutes until soft and golden. Keep warm.

Step 2 of 3

Beat the milk, eggs, Parmesan and a little salt and pepper together in a bowl. Pour into a shallow dish. Melt half the butter in a large frying pan. Dip 3 bread slices into the egg mixture, add to the pan and fry over a medium heat for 3-4 minutes, turning once, until golden on both sides. Remove and keep warm in a moderate oven. Repeat with the remaining bread slices and egg mixture.

Step 3 of 3

Serve the eggy bread topped with the grilled tomatoes, baby spinach leaves and a few basil leaves.
